4) Reinstall the piston rings into the piston groovesPush in
the ring until the outer surface of the piston ring is nearly flush with the piston and measure the side clearance using feeler gaugeStandard
Service limit

TOP second Oil

0.0250.055 mm (0.00100.0022 in) 0.0550.1 40 mm (0.00220.0055 in)

0.10 mm (0.004 in) 0.20 mm (0.008 in)

dASSEMBLY
1) Clean the piston and carefully install the piston rings
Take care not to damage the piston ring by spreading the ends too farBe careful not to damage the piston during the piston ring removalClean carbon deposits from the piston ring grooves with ring that will be discardedNever use wire brush; it will scratch the groovesDo not confuse the top and second ringsThe top ring is chrome-coated and second not coatedInstall the top and second rings with the mark facing UP Oil ring; first install the spacer then install the side rails2) After installing the ring make sure that they rotate freely,
